In the vast expanse of the universe, there exist tiny particles that govern the behavior of matter and energy. The study of nuclear physics has gained significant attention in recent years, thanks to advancements in technology and the growing need for innovative solutions in fields like energy production and medical research.
Nuclear physics deals with the behavior of atomic nuclei, which comprise protons and neutrons. These particles interact through fundamental forces like the strong and weak nuclear forces. By studying these interactions, scientists can gain insights into the structure and properties of matter, from the lightest elements to the heaviest subatomic particles.
A nucleus is the central part of an atom, consisting of protons and neutrons. Protons have a positive charge, while neutrons are neutral.Common Questions
